- Day 1
Porto
You'll arrive at Porto airport and head to your hotel in the historic city centre. The medieval neighbourhoods here are part of a UNESCO World Heritage Site, so there's a lot to take in. Plan to walk through the Ribeira area with its narrow streets and riverside views, then check out the Port wine cellars where you can learn about how the wine gets produced and aged. By evening, you'll have dinner at one of the local restaurants, many of which offer traditional Portuguese cuisine.

- Day 3
Ria de Aveiro
You'll cycle toward Ria de Aveiro, known locally as the Portuguese Venice because of its waterways. Once there, you get to ride in traditional moliceiro boats and navigate through the canals yourself. The area also has salt pans you can see from your bike route. Stop to try Ovos Moles de Aveiro, a local sweet treat made from egg yolks and sugar that's sold in convents and shops throughout the region.

- Day 4
Aveiro to Figueira da Foz
Today's route goes through lagoons and canals with Terra Nova's colourful striped houses appearing along the way. You'll pass traditional wooden palheiros structures lining the Mira canal as you cycle. The landscape includes protected dunes that create a scenic backdrop. By the end of the day, you reach Figueira da Foz where a long sandy beach stretches out for swimming or just relaxing after cycling.

Figueira da Foz to Nazaré
You'll head south on the Silver Coast using the Estrada Atlântica path, which takes you through the historic Pinhal de Leiria forest. The route passes through pine groves and eventually leads to São Pedro do Moel, where distinctive rocky cliffs meet a small bay. From there, you continue to Nazaré, a fishing village that's known around the world for its massive winter waves. The village itself has traditional charm and working fishing boats.

Nazaré to Óbidos
Your ride takes you from Nazaré inland to Óbidos, a medieval town sitting on top of a hill. Before leaving Nazaré, you can explore the fishing village's traditions and see how the local culture connects to the sea. Óbidos rewards you with whitewashed houses and narrow streets that feel frozen in time, with stone walls surrounding the town. Try ginginha, a local cherry liqueur, which is often served in small chocolate cups.
